Rectangular Connectors - Headers, Receptacles, Female Sockets

Rectangular Connectors (also known as Interconnect systems) are a type of electrical connector used for a variety of applications including power distribution, signal routing, and network communication. They are commonly used in the industrial, consumer electronics, and automotive industries. Rectangular Connectors are available in a variety of sizes and styles, with the most common types being Headers, Receptacles, and Female Sockets.
